I am in my 7 th week post Tkr. Am 78. I went to the PT yesterday & he seemed quite pleased with me but always makes me feel I don't put enough into my exercising. I'm g My bend is 105 , he asked how much I walked & I had to confess @ 20 minutes he said I needed to do twice that SO this morning I went off for one HOUR ,since I came home my knee has been 'burning hot' even tho I have ice on it. Help !!!! Have I caused a set back & yet another sleepless night to come. It feels hopeless.

Oh Dolores I am so sorry you've also over done it. When you feel good & PT tells you to up exercise we DO try too hard. I have been told by over doing it we cannot cause damage, it just hurts like mad I'm on my 2 nd day since I went on my too long a walk & my knee stil feels so extremely stiff. Though after not sleeping hardly at all the first night it was much better the 2nd night. When you've over done it I think it takes a few days to recover , I've really just been resting as much as I can with ice on & doing very easy & gentle exercises to keep it moving. I really hope that you will soon feel better, I'm sure it's just time,rest & ice. the constant pain & sleepless nights do get to you & we have good days & bad.
